1. Understand Generator Noise
Generators typically produce noise levels ranging from 50 to 90 decibels (dB), depending on their size and type. Noise sources include:
- Engine Operation: Vibrations from internal combustion engines.
- Exhaust System: The primary contributor to noise.
- Cooling Fans: Essential for regulating generator temperature but often noisy.
2. Soundproofing Techniques
a. Use a Soundproof Enclosure
- Pre-Made Enclosures: Purchase an acoustic enclosure specifically designed for portable generators.
- DIY Enclosures: Build one using materials like MDF boards and acoustic foam. Ensure adequate ventilation to prevent overheating.
b. Install a Muffler
- Upgrade the generator’s stock muffler to a quieter model designed for noise reduction.
- Work with a professional to ensure compatibility and proper installation.
c. Positioning and Placement
- Place the generator on a level surface to reduce vibrations.
- Position it as far as possible from living areas or neighbors.
d. Use Anti-Vibration Pads
- Place these pads under the generator to absorb vibrations and reduce noise transmission to the ground.
e. Add Acoustic Barriers
- Set up soundproof panels or blankets around the generator to block noise.
- Use materials like mass-loaded vinyl (MLV) for better sound insulation.
3. Ensure Proper Ventilation
While soundproofing, ensure the generator gets adequate airflow:
- Create vents in the enclosure with acoustic ducts to direct noise away while allowing air circulation.
- Install fans if necessary to prevent overheating.
4. Consider Noise-Reducing Accessories
- Exhaust Extensions: Direct exhaust noise away from sensitive areas.
- Noise Reduction Kits: Many manufacturers offer kits to reduce generator noise levels.
5. Test and Adjust
Once the soundproofing measures are in place:
- Test the noise levels using a decibel meter to ensure significant reduction.
- Monitor the generator’s temperature to confirm it remains within safe operating limits.
6. Alternative Solutions
- Inverter Generators: Consider investing in inverter generators, which are generally quieter and more fuel-efficient than traditional models.
- Underground Installation: For permanent setups, burying the generator in a soundproof pit can further reduce noise.
